Abstract: In the talk we will first introduce HPC Lab research group at ISTI-CNR in Pisa and the H2020 Marie Slodowska-Curie European Project MASTER involving HPC Lab and UFSC with the objective of forming an international and inter-sectoral network of researchers working on multiple-aspects semantic trajectories. In the second part of the talk we will survey some recent research results of the group in the field of efficient algorithms for big data analytics and machine learning. The talk will focus on different application fields — e.g., ranking in web search, indexing of semantic data, event attendance prediction from social media — characterised by demanding requirements for scalability, efficiency and effectiveness.

Speaker’s Short Bio: Raffaele Perego is a senior researcher at ISTI, where he leads the HPC Lab. His main research interests include: large-scale information systems, web search, data mining and machine learning. Raffaele Perego co-authored more than 170 papers on these topics. He coordinated activities in several EC projects in the FP7 and H2020 work programmes. In 2014, he was a recipient of the Yahoo FREP award, and in 2015 co-recipient of the ACM SIGIR Best Paper Award. He was general Co-Chair of ACM SIGIR 2016 Conference.
